Directed by Maria Robertson, co-directed by Harry Pearson and produced by Maddison Gould, Home Sweet Home is a short film collaboration between animation and VFX students at Escape Studios.
The BAFF is an annual film festival that takes place at the Empire Leicester Square in London's West End. Tickets can be purchased through Cineworld.